Output 72e68a020e423637a8e14f1c1edf2a61c65b4f788cbbb7da54a893170b7c2e3f:1

value
2849998664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 676c82a04b1b92a5b7bbbda707ebc96245dda171 OP_EQUAL
address
3B7sWj8bvsDeAbpcNNfDAm2iBKANw4gUXd
transaction
72e68a020e423637a8e14f1c1edf2a61c65b4f788cbbb7da54a893170b7c2e3f
spent
true